#196eaa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#196eaa is composed of 9.8% red, 43.1%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 35.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 204.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 38.2%. #196eaa color hex could be obtained by blending #32dcff with #000055.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#196eaa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#196eaa has RGB values of R:25, G:110, B:170 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 1666730.

Shades and Tints of #196eaa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a10 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#196eaa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6267 is the less saturated color, while #0272c1 is the most saturated one.
